
Silica Dust Management: Meeting OSHA Standards for Job Site Safety
This technical briefing evaluates OSHA silica dust compliance for stone masonry operations in 2026, focusing on engineering controls to meet the 0.05 mg/m³ PEL. We analyze the health risks of respirable crystalline silica and provide a strategic framework for maintaining written exposure plans and medical surveillance. The guide details the operational advantages of utilizing CNC wet-processing and pre-fabricated L-corners to reduce on-site dust generation, alongside protocols for managing chemical waste and heat safety. For B2B organizations, these standards are the primary defense against $165,514 willful violation penalties and ensure long-term project continuity.
